Title: New D1 level set WIP: Nefarious Assault
Post by: Sapphirus on August 30, 2010, 01:40:58 PM
I'm currently working on a 16+3 level set for Descent 1 called 'Nefarious Assault', It'll feature robot sound replacements (mostly from Descent 2), custom textures for each level (within each .DTX files for Rebirth, and within the 'mods\nefarius\textures\levelxx' directory for XL), and perhaps new soundtrack.
(NOTE for the Rebirth Users: Before loading this level in D1X-Rebirth, play a level, turn the cockpit off before jumping into this one)

What is it please that makes up the "D1" feeling? Textures? Sounds? Weapons? Robots? You can use only those from D1 in any D2X-XL mission. Btw, I wasn't saying he had to convert the mission (in a sense of trying to force him into it).
Title: Re: New D1 level set WIP: Nefarious Assault
Post by: Scyphi on July 10, 2011, 03:30:15 PM
I dunno what makes up the D1 feeling Karx, I really wish I could tell you so you could use you're almighty programming skills to apply it. But just something about D2 taints the D1 feel. Not that this is a bad thing. It just means that D2 has it's own feel that's different from D1.

Also, building things within the limitations of the original D1 adds to the challenge for the level builder, and if successful, adds to the charm for the player of the level. Some of my favorite D1 levels are my favorites simply because of what the builder was creative enough to accomplish within D1 that made you stop and wonder how they did it, whereas in D2 on up, the mystery is lessened somewhat.

Again, not that there's anything wrong with that. It's just...some days you want to do it the hard way. :)

I'm sure Sapphire Wolf has his own reasons as well.
Title: Re: New D1 level set WIP: Nefarious Assault
Post by: SaladBadger on July 10, 2011, 03:47:25 PM
I am willing to bet that half of the reason why D1 levels feel so different in D2 is because of the palettes -- many of the D1 textures did not transfer over to the D2 palettes very well, and this just kinda kills them in several cases (see that door with the four rectangular panels? I'm talking about that.) Naturally, since D2X-XL already supports high-color textures and DXX-Rebirth, in theroy, after the .PIG addon system is complete, could possibly support high-color textures, this part of the issue could be solved.

I'd also cite robot sounds and the crippling of the D1 bosses as part of the problem
